Meat and Kidney Turnover

A classic British dish combining tender beef and lamb kidneys in a rich ragù wrapped in golden puff pastry. This comforting meal with deep, complex flavors will delight traditional food lovers.

🛒 Ingredients

4 servings

4
  • 300g Puff Pastry
  • Beaten Egg White
  • Beaten Egg Yolk
  • 2 tsp Vegetable Oil
  • 700g Braising Beef, cut into cubes
  • 200g Lamb Kidneys, cleaned and cut
  • 2 finely chopped Onions
  • 30g Flour
  • 250 ml Beef Stock
  • Salt and Pepper
  • 1 dash Worcestershire Sauce

Directions

  1. 1

    Preheat the oven to 220°C (425°F)

  2. 2

    Heat oil in a large pan and brown the beef all over (repeat as necessary). Set aside.

  3. 3

    In the same pan, brown the lamb kidneys on both sides. Set aside.

  4. 4

    Add onions and cook for 3-4 minutes

  5. 5

    Return the beef to the pan, sprinkle with flour, and coat the meat and onions well.

  6. 6

    Pour in the stock, mix well, and bring to a boil

  7. 7

    Reduce heat and let simmer for 1h30 without covering. Add more stock if liquid evaporates too much.

  8. 8

    Transfer the mixture to a dish suitable for oven, cover with puff pastry, and glaze with egg white.

  9. 9

    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es or until the pastry is golden brown

💡 Chef's Tip

Clean lamb kidneys thoroughly and remove any white membranes. The Worcestershire sauce adds a subtle depth to the stock. Prepare the ragù a day ahead for even better results.
